Enum Constant Detail
-
UNKNOWN
public static final OSPolicyAssignmentReport.OSPolicyCompliance.OSPolicyResourceCompliance.ComplianceState UNKNOWN
The resource is in an unknown compliance state. To get more details about why the policy is in this state, review the output of the `compliance_state_reason` field.
UNKNOWN = 0;
-
COMPLIANT
public static final OSPolicyAssignmentReport.OSPolicyCompliance.OSPolicyResourceCompliance.ComplianceState COMPLIANT
Resource is compliant.
COMPLIANT = 1;
-
NON_COMPLIANT
public static final OSPolicyAssignmentReport.OSPolicyCompliance.OSPolicyResourceCompliance.ComplianceState NON_COMPLIANT
Resource is non-compliant.
NON_COMPLIANT = 2;
